National city placement
According to ACS 5-Year Estimates, Duck Creek Village, UT sits among US cities with a below-median household income, on a village-scale population base, across a single-ZIP footprint.

ZIP Codes in Duck Creek Village, UT
These ZIP codes sit in Kane County, which covers 7 ZIP codes in all; 1 of them fall in Duck Creek Village. See the Kane County roll-up →
Duck Creek Village sits in the lower half of Kane County on income: Kanab, Orderville and Mount Carmel report more, and only Glendale reports less. Kanab marks the far end of that range at $85,417, 31% above Duck Creek Village.
